The Tradition of Engagement Rings
The tradition of exchanging rings goes back thousands of years. In many cultures, engagement rings always represent love and commitment, usually worn by women. The custom is thought to have originated in ancient Egypt, and it has rings made of braided reeds to symbolize eternity.
In the West, the custom became common in the 15th century when diamonds were brought in. Traditionally, a woman was only given a ring as a sign of being “taken.” However, times have changed. Today, tons of men also wear a ring as a sign of their commitment, so it’s another symbol of love that the couple shares.
Men’s Engagement Rings Around the World
Do men wear engagement rings? There are answers to this depending on the culture. It’s been a long-standing tradition in some countries while a newer concept in others.
- In Scandinavian countries, both men and women wear rings – think Sweden, Norway (and even Iceland).
- A lot of people in Argentina, for example, exchange rings before marriage as a sign of commitment.
But in much of the Western world, it’s still rare for men to wear engagement ring. This, however, is changing as couples adopt new traditions. Now, the engagement ring is an increasingly personal decision and not a cultural requirement.

Types of Engagement Rings for Men: Styles and Materials
When it comes to engagement rings for men, the field is just like wedding bands – there are a lot of different styles and materials to choose from.
Here are some common options:
- Classic Metal Bands: Offer a timeless and elegant style.
- Modern Designs: Black tungsten, carbon fibre, and matte finishes are a bold new style.
- Accents in Diamond: A few small diamonds or engraving give a bit of class.
- Silicone Rings: Flexible and durable choice for the active lifestyle.
There are so many options that every man can discover a ring that fits his personality and taste exactly.
